Transaction 86d232aacbf33b7f8b12f1b955c1fd48498bf4cd42019d441550dafb7ae6d9ec
1 Input
1 Output
-
86d232aacbf33b7f8b12f1b955c1fd48498bf4cd42019d441550dafb7ae6d9ec:0
- value
- 32559577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ad96e257ce4c59ba94ad1b70a732ef6c659120e6 OP_EQUAL
- address
- MPj1tEPAXnnoxiWmNDVnwDK3tVufumANd6